A Fast-Moving Wildfire Forces 20,000 From France's Atlantic Coast

A wildfire that broke out on July 22, 2026, in dense pine forest near the village of Saumos — about 40 km west of Bordeaux and just north of the Bay of Arcachon — burned 2,400 hectares (5,928 acres) in under 24 hours and forced the evacuation of more than 20,000 people, including thousands of tourists, from France's south-west Atlantic coast The Guardian.
As of July 23, no casualties or destroyed homes had been reported. Seven hundred firefighters and four waterbombing planes — aircraft specifically equipped to drop large volumes of water or retardant on forest fires — were deployed. The Gironde prefecture (the local arm of central government administration in that département) described the situation as still dangerous, stating that conditions "remain unfavourable" The Guardian.
The fire advanced from Saumos toward the commune of Le Porge and then toward Lège Cap-Ferret, following the prevailing wind direction through the Landes forest corridor Gironde Prefecture. Flames reached 10 metres high, fanned by strong wind and tinder-dry conditions after France endured three almost back-to-back heatwaves since May 2026 The Guardian.
Evacuations happened in phases. The initial overnight evacuation on July 22 moved roughly 600 people from the immediate Saumos area, including a camping site and about one hundred residents of the Porge North-East neighbourhood, who were sheltered in a communal hall Gironde Prefecture; Reuters. Reuters independently confirmed that more than 10,000 people were evacuated overnight as the fire rapidly spread Reuters. The phased evacuations continued through July 23: 10,000 overnight, 2,000 in the morning, and roughly 8,800 at midday, bringing the total above 20,000 The Guardian. Nine local municipalities opened reception centres sheltering more than 2,500 evacuees.
Roads leading to the Cap Ferret peninsula were closed to all but essential traffic, and road traffic was diverted away from popular beaches in the area during the July 22 phase of the response The Guardian; Reuters. Police opened an investigation into the fire's causes. The mayor of Le Porge said the blaze appeared to have been started by a machine clearing undergrowth — a detail that, if confirmed, would place the ignition in the category of human activity rather than natural causes such as lightning The Guardian.
A separate wildfire near Pontevès, roughly 70 km north of Toulon in south-eastern France, burned 2,500 hectares and destroyed at least 10 houses before being stabilised on July 23. The simultaneous occurrence of major fires in both south-western and south-eastern France placed considerable strain on national firefighting resources during a prolonged, heat-driven fire season The Guardian.
The Saumos fire follows a precedent set in 2022, when a wildfire in the same area burned more than 30,000 hectares and forced about 50,000 evacuations. The Landes pine forest, which dominates the coastal strip from Arcachon southward, is a fire-adapted ecosystem — one that has evolved alongside periodic burning and tends to produce heavy fuel loads of resinous litter and undergrowth. Combined with recurring heatwaves, that accumulated material becomes highly combustible. The 2026 fire season's three heatwaves since May preconditioned that fuel matrix well before the July 22 ignition, and the strong winds that drove the flames to 10 metres in height exploited those conditions with notable efficiency.
The broader context here is one of recurring vulnerability. The same geographic corridor has now produced two mass-evacuation wildfire events within four years, both linked to dry, hot conditions in the Landes forest during summer months. The Saumos fire burned a smaller area than the 2022 event but moved with comparable speed, consuming 2,400 hectares in under 24 hours. The phased evacuation response, the deployment of waterbombing aircraft, and the activation of reception centres across nine municipalities reflect an operational template refined since the 2022 season, though the prefecture's assessment that conditions "remain unfavourable" indicates the fire was not yet contained as of July 23.
The investigation into the suspected mechanical ignition point raises a separate set of questions about land-management practices in high-risk forest zones. Undergrowth clearing is itself a fire-prevention measure designed to reduce fuel loads, but when conducted during periods of extreme heat and low humidity, the machinery itself can become the ignition source. That paradox is well documented in Mediterranean fire-management literature. Whether operational protocols for seasonal restrictions on mechanical clearing in the Landes forest will be revisited in the aftermath of Saumos is a question for French civil-protection authorities.
